What is Double Glazing?
Double glazing refers to the installation of two panes of glass with an area in between, generally filled with an inert gas like argon or krypton. This structure enhances thermal insulation, minimizing heat loss in the winter and keeping homes cooler throughout the summer season. While basic double glazing can use numerous benefits, "certified" double glazing represents a greater standard of quality and performance, ensuring that the product fulfills specific industry benchmarks.

Choosing the right certified double glazing for your home involves a number of steps:

Research Certification Bodies: Familiarize yourself with organizations that certify glazing items (e.g., British Standards Institute - BSI, or Energy Star in the USA).

Compare Products: Look for glazing systems with favorable U-values and noise reduction ratings.

Look For Professional Installation: Certified products must constantly be installed by qualified experts to ensure proper fitting and optimum efficiency.

Consider Your Environment: Select glazing that matches your specific climate conditions to optimize energy performance.
